CALCulate<Chn>:TRANsform:DTFault:DELete
<DtfDeleteCable>
Deletes the user-defined cable type with the given name.
Suffix:
<Chn>
.
Channel number
This suffix is ignored: cable types are defined for (and deleted
from) all channels.
Setting parameters:
<DtfDeleteCable>
Name of a user-defined cable type.
Example:
CALCulate:TRANsform:DTFault:DELete 'My cable
type'
Deletes the user-defined cable type "My cable type".
Usage:
Setting only
